Understanding Warehouse Jobs

Before diving into applications, I took a moment to understand what warehouse jobs entail. These positions typically involve tasks such as picking, packing, shipping, receiving, and inventory management. Some roles might require operating heavy machinery, while others focus on manual labor. Knowing what to expect helped me decide which positions I wanted to pursue.

Identifying Your Skills and Preferences

I found it beneficial to reflect on my own skills and what I enjoy doing. For example, I’ve always been good at organizing and working in fast-paced environments. This self-assessment helped me target warehouse jobs that aligned with my strengths. Here are some skills and attributes that can be valuable in warehouse roles:

  • Physical Stamina: Many warehouse jobs require lifting and moving heavy items.
  • Attention to Detail: Accuracy is crucial in order fulfillment and inventory management.
  • Team Player: Most warehouse environments rely on teamwork to ensure efficiency.

Where to Look for Immediate Openings

After defining my skills, I focused on where to find immediate warehouse openings. Here’s what worked for me:

  • Job Boards: Websites like Indeed, Monster, and Glassdoor often list warehouse positions that are hiring urgently. I set up alerts to get notifications for new listings.
  • Company Websites: I visited the career pages of major retailers and logistics companies, which frequently have job openings and sometimes even offer bonuses for immediate hires.
  • Local Classifieds: I found some local warehouse jobs listed in community newspapers and online classifieds. It’s worth checking these out for hidden gems.

Preparing My Application

When I applied for jobs, I made sure my resume highlighted relevant experience, even if it was from different industries. Here are some tips I followed:

  • Tailor My Resume: I customized my resume for each application, emphasizing skills that matched the job description.
  • Write a Cover Letter: Although not always required, I found that a brief cover letter explaining my interest and availability made a positive impression.
  • Include References: If possible, I included references from previous employers or supervisors who could vouch for my work ethic.

Nailing the Interview

If I got called for an interview, I took time to prepare. Here’s how I approached it:

  • Research the Company: I learned about the company’s values and culture, which allowed me to ask informed questions during the interview.
  • Practice Common Questions: I rehearsed answers to common interview questions related to warehouse work, such as handling tight deadlines or working with a team.
  • Dress Appropriately: Even though warehouse jobs may not require formal attire, I made sure to dress neatly to convey professionalism.

Understanding Pay and Benefits

One critical factor I considered before accepting any job was the pay and benefits package. I researched average salaries for warehouse positions in my area to ensure I was receiving a fair offer. Additionally, I looked into benefits such as health insurance, overtime pay, and any potential for bonuses or raises.
